 Laura Mercier Smooth Finish Flawless Fluid
 This foundation makes my skin look beautiful, natural and flawless. It blurs out my imperfections and it doesn't emphasize any texture or bumps on my skin. It's a strong light/medium coverage (it won't cover up my really stubborn pimples) but it's perfect to even out my skin tone. I love it so much more because if I have spots I need to cover,  I can build up the foundation and it does NOT look cakey, all other foundations I've tried to build up have always looked too cakey on my dry skin but this one blends so beautifully you can't even tell. I apply my powder contour, blush and highlight and they sit so nice and last really long over this foundation.
Laura Mercier Shade in Golden



Pros: Lightweight, Natural flawless finish, Matte,  Smooth finish, Easy to apply, build-able without looking cakey, blend-able, minimizes pores, blurs imperfections (scars,texture, laugh lines) , doesn't cling to dry patches,  long lasting, oil-free, non-comedogenic
Cons: A bit leaky

Application: I moisturize with First Aid Beauty Ultra Repair Creme and then I apply Makeup Forever Skin Equalizer Primer. I shake the foundation then I tap it upside down so that the product doesn't leak when I open it. I need about 3-4 pumps for my whole face. I dab the foundation around my skin and spread it out with my fingers, then I blend it out with my Real Techniques sponge!

Laura Mercier Translucent Setting Powder
I know this product has been really popular but I can confirm it was made through the hands of an angel. I'm kidding, but SERIOUSLY it's so hard to find a powder that won't make me look dryer and still give me that "porcelain doll" look to my skin! This powder makes my skin look soft, I love it. I can use this to "cake/bake" my dry under eyes and it won't look thick, powdery, or heavy after I dust it off.



Pros: Lightweight, Smooth, Natural, Flawless, Mattifying, Creaseless, Long Lasting,
Application: After applying foundation I lightly dust a small amount all over my face with a kabuki brush. I pat it around my skin with the brush. I use the Real Techniques sponge sometimes to pat it onto my undereyes to really set my concealer.

I have been wanting to try this eye shadow palette since it came out but it was always out of stock at Sephora. Kat Von D created this palette for contouring and enhancing eyes! It comes in 3 quads and they're arranged by neutral, cool and warm shades.  This palette has this little guide to help with eye-contouring techniques. I found it easy to follow, I'm not a make-up artists so these tips and tricks were very useful for me! You can lift, define or balance eyes with this palette. The color selection is beautiful, I really have no complaints for this palette. Every day I've used it I'm impressed by the quality of the shades. I've created everyday to dramatic night looks and I love the outcome every time. I am a fan of matte eye shadows, I wear them way more than shimmery and if you're like me you should definitely check this palette out, I guarantee you won't be disappointed.
